60 Kg of Waste Transported from Tugu Selatan

Gerebek Lumpur in Tugu Selatan targets drains in residential areas

60 kg of plastic waste were successfully transported from Gerebek Lumpur activities in Tugu Selatan, Koja, North Jakarta, on Friday (10/2). The plastic waste was then used as savings in the Berkah Waste Bank.

Tugu Selatan Urban Village Head Sukamin explained that it was done in all RW areas in the morning until in the afternoon.

"Gerebek Lumpur in Tugu Selatan targets drains in residential areas. It is aimed to anticipate the rainy season," he expressed.

He expressed those plastic waste transported consisted of plastic bags, packaged food wrappers, drink glasses to used bottles. After being sorted and cleaned, plastic waste was weighed in the waste bank for economic value.

"Hopefully residents will sort plastic waste from home, thus it doesn't pollute the environment and trigger blockage of drains," he stated.
